PROCEDURE
实验过程
To a solution of 2,2,6,6-tetramethyl-piperidine, (1.18 mL, 0.00700 mol) in tetrahydrofuran (30 mL, 0.4 mol) at −78° C. was added n-butyllithium in hexane (2.5 M, 3.7 mL). After stirring for 15 min., a suspension of niacin (0.287 g, 0.00233 mol) in THF was added and the mixture was stired at −78° C. for 10 min. The reaction mixture was then warmed to −55° C. for 60 min. A solution of 1-{[1-(2,4-dichlorophenyl)cyclopropyl]carbonyl}pyrrolidin-3-one (580 mg, 0.0019 mol) in THF (2 mL) was added to the above mixture and stirring was continued at −55 degrees celsius for 20 min. The reaction mixture was then allowed to warm to rt for 1 h and then acidified (pH˜1) using 6M HCl aq. solution. The reaction mixture was stirred at rt overnight and then neutralized (pH˜7). The product from the mixture was extracted with AcOEt. The organic extract was washed with brine, dried with MgSO4, and concentrated in-vauo. The crude product was purified by Combiflash followed by separation of the enantiomers using a chrial column. LCMS: m/z 402.0 & 404.0 (M+H)+.
